Respondents Prayer:- Writ Petition is filed, under the Article 226 of Constitution of India, to issue a Writ of Certorarified Mandamus, directing the respondents to consider petitioner's representation datd 20.09.2022 to undertake repair activities at D.No14/19, Thiru.Vi.Ka.Road, Royapettah, Chennai - 600 014 and to regularize the rent and also her tenancy on the lease-hold property.

O R D E R

This Writ Petition has been filed to direct the respondents to consider petitioner's representation dated 20.09.2022 to undertake repair activities at D.No14/19, Thiru.Vi.Ka.Road, Royapettah, Chennai600 014 and to regularize the rent and also her tenancy on the leasehold property.

2. Based upon instructions, dated 14.10.2022 and 10.10.2022 and also the copy of the paper publication for the general public in respect of tender scheduled to be held on 14.09.2022 and also the auction registered, the learned Spl.G.P. and learned Government Advocate contended that in respect of Door No.19 in S.No.328/1, there were arrears to an extent of 12,936 sq.ft. and the same is fixed on the tender price amount and the shop residential cover card and in the only public auction, one person Mr.A.Sankar, Vyasarpadi, Chennai - 39 has taken the tender on the monthly rent on 14.10.2022 and the same was 2/5

accepted as per 14.10.2022 proceedings and hence, I find that the representation is only to circumvent the calculation of arrears rent, and hence, I am inclined to grant direction as sought for.

3. The learned counsel for the petitioner would submit that the petitioner is not aware of the statement given by the Government and also the subsequent development said to have been taken. In the event she was served upon them, it is open to the petitioner to file appropriate application for the necessary relief before the appropriate Court.

4. The writ petition is disposed of in the above terms. No costs. 09.03.2023 nvi Index:Yes/No To
